Overview

Problem Critical operations in commercial aviation and defense rely on outdated processes using paper checklists and human reporting. These methods are slow, error-prone, and lack real-time visibility. This causes mistakes, and delays missions. As aviation and defense demand faster readiness, and digital traceability, traditional methods can’t keep pace.

Solution AEROSENS’ sensor-enabled platforms (AeroCMS and AeroISU) automate readiness checks for aircraft equipment and provides in-transit visibility and tamper detection for cargo, replacing blind manual processes with verifiable digital certainty.

Field Validation AeroISU: AFWERX Phase II, under TACFI with the 621st CRG. AeroCMS: AFWERX Phase I and pilots with British Airways and JetBlue.

Technology Maturity (TRL) Both platforms are at TRL 6

Strategic Advantage AeroCMS is patented and FAA/FCC/CE certified, with deep workflow integration. AeroISU has a patent-pending ultra-secure BLE sensor. Years of validation give us timing, compliance, and integration advantages

Go-to-Market Access Advancing through AFWERX SBIR, TACFI, and OTA consortia . Commercial sales via HEICO and direct channels, backed by Boeing portfolio selection

Dual-Use Potential Global logistics, energy, rail, and emergency response

Team Maria Martinez (CEO) – Telecoms Eng., ESADE MBA Reza Shibli (CTO) – CS, McGill University

Competitive Landscape RFID firms like ASD offer only proximity scans. Defense players like Savi and SkyBitz require connectivity and complex infrastructure

Primary User AeroISU: AMC, CRG, AIT/ITV AeroCMS: Fleet Maintenance Heads

User-Critical Problem Manual tracking leads to missed inspections and lost visibility. Poor tools and training cause delays and misreporting.
